Why granite is often the smartest choice for kitchen counters

Kitchen counters must handle heat, movement, cleaning and constant use. Granite is popular because it balances strength with a premium natural look.

Think about daily pressure, not only the look

Kitchen surfaces face hot pans, chopping, spills and repeated cleaning, so the stone has to be chosen with performance in mind.

Granite gives that durability while still offering a strong visual character, especially in darker tones or soft mineral patterns.

  • Strong choice for active family kitchens
  • Good resistance for counters and islands
  • Suitable for bold contrast layouts

Plan the cuts, joints and edge details early

Before fabrication, the team should confirm sink openings, hob cutouts, edge profile and backsplash height.

A clear plan avoids awkward joins and helps the final counter look like one complete surface instead of separate pieces.

  • Measure sink and hob openings first
  • Approve the edge before polishing starts
  • Keep backsplash and counter line aligned

What our team checks before installation

We look at the room layout, access for lifting and the finish level required by the client.

That means we can suggest a stone that feels premium but still works for the way the kitchen is actually used.

If the kitchen is busy or open to the living area, granite is often one of the safest choices because it delivers both strength and style.
